Bad weather ILINA – Yiannis Kallianos at newsit.gr: Strong storms in many areas, Monday and Tuesday warning

Meteorologist Yiannis Kallianos told newsit.gr that a new wave of bad weather is expected to affect most parts of our country from tomorrow, Monday (04.03.2023). Earlier, EMY had issued an emergency notice on bad weather, recommending civil defense caution and giving appropriate instructions to citizens.

“Unstable weather will characterize the coming week for most parts of the country,” says meteorologist Yiannis Kallianos, speaking to newsit.gr. Meteorologist and ND MP explains, “The main features of this weather change are rain, showers, heavy storms which will create problems as lightning activity will be better”.

Many areas will experience localized flooding, especially on Monday and Tuesday. “Mondays and Tuesdays require special attention. More specifically, tomorrow Monday mainly in western and northern Greece and Tuesday in the eastern Aegean islands. In these areas, rains and local storms are often very strong,” meteorologist Yiannis Kallianos tells newsit.gr.

According to meteorologist Yiannis Kallianos newsit.gr, it will also rain in the capital. “The next few days will also see occasional rain in Attica, where local storms are possible, although this is not expected, at least with the data so far, with the possibility of some strong events creating problems, even at the local level,” he notes.

As for the temperature, as a well-known meteorologist says, “the temperature will drop by 5-6 points in the next few days compared to the very high weekend temperatures in most parts of Greece”.

Winds up to 8 Beaufort, African dust noticeable

Winds over the next few days “will be strong 7-8 Beaufort offshore through Tuesday. They will turn northerly and weaken slightly beginning Wednesday.” African dust makes its presence felt. “There will be dust from Africa in the next few days, which will cloud the atmosphere. So, most of the rain will be muddy,” he said.

Rain through Thursday

All in all, as meteorologist Yiannis Kallianos explains to newsit.gr, “At least until Thursday, this rain will be maintained on Monday and Tuesday, with very difficult days. On Wednesday and Thursday, the weather will be slightly milder, and on Thursday and Friday it will rain again, which will cover most of the country. affect.”
